Still looking for the following scenery addons to get my FS9 install updated (all relate to RealNZ sceneries):

- kaikoura20m.zip (for RealNZ Kaikoura to fix buildings floating when using RBE 20m mesh)
- wgtn101.zip (tunnel and runway numbering fix for RealNZ Wellington)
- Marlborough Hard Winter .bat file (fixes the HardWinter texture problem with RealNZ Marlborough) and
- Queen's wharf fix (a harden for RealNZ Wellington Queen's wharf to allow Charl's 10 Squirrels heli addon to function properly).

Any assistance would be most appreciated. TIA.
